The Best Value Dual Fuel Range Cooker
Addition of a dual-fuel range cooker is a great upgrade for your kitchen. It can also add value to your home. However, it's essential to understand the costs involved so that you can make an informed choice.
This dual fuel range cook features both a gas stove as well as an electric oven. It gives you the best of two worlds. The controls are dials, and it comes with a reversible ring and griddle to increase the cooking capabilities.

Features
A dual fuel range cooker blends a gas cooktop with an electric oven to give the best of both worlds. Some cooks prefer the control that comes with cooking with gas, whereas others prefer the uniform and quick heat provided by an electric oven. No matter what you prefer the features of this kind of stove are worth taking into consideration as they will enable you to cook gourmet meals with ease.
The dimensions of your kitchen will influence the selection of a dual-fuel range cooker. You should select one that will fit in the space available, whether you're replacing an old model or re-designing your kitchen entirely. This is particularly important when you're purchasing a dual-fuel freestanding unit. There are many models available in different widths to fit different kitchen designs.
Another thing to take into consideration is the performance of the burners and Best Value Dual Fuel Range Cooker the capacity of the oven. If you plan on using the cooktop frequently it is recommended to pick a model with high BTU capabilities. The more powerful the BTU rating of a burner is, the more hot it becomes. This is essential for cooking pasta or sear a steak. It is also important to know the oven's maximum capacity, since it will determine the size of the food you can cook.
You should also consider how you would like your new range cooker to look in your home. You can select from a range of colors offered by a majority of manufacturers to match your style. You may also choose from a number of door styles and handles. Some models are designed to have an elegant, clean appearance, while others are rustic or traditional.
If you are planning to install a dual fuel range in an existing kitchen, it is essential to have a professional do the installation. Installation of these appliances is more complex than a conventional stove because they require separate hookups for the gas line and electrical outlet. It is also necessary to have the voltage of the electrical outlet changed by an electrician.
